The nurse is discussing diabetic foot care with a client. Which statement accurately reflects the importance of regular foot inspections?
"Regular foot inspections can help you choose fashionable and comfortable footwear."
"Inspecting your feet daily can help you identify potential problems and prevent complications."
"Foot inspections are only necessary if you develop an infection or injury."
"You should inspect your feet weekly to ensure proper hygiene."
The Correct Answer is B
Regular foot inspections, done on a daily basis, help individuals with diabetes identify early signs of problems such as cuts, blisters, or changes in skin integrity. This enables timely intervention to prevent further complications.
Incorrect choices:
a. This choice is incorrect. While choosing comfortable footwear is important, the primary purpose of daily foot inspections is to identify and prevent complications, not fashion.
c. This choice is incorrect. Foot inspections should be performed routinely to prevent complications, rather than waiting for an infection or injury to develop.
d. This choice is incorrect. Weekly foot inspections may not provide timely detection of potential problems, as complications can arise rapidly in individuals with diabetes.
